India and Southeast Asia - 1860
Note: to view one of two available close-ups of this picture, click on the area you wish to see. A lithographed and hand-colored mid-19th century map of this region, by one of the major cartographic publishers working in America at this date. This map shows India, Tibet, China, Burma, Cambodia, the island of Formosa, and parts of the East Indies. It shows political boundaries, names dozens of then important cities and boasts a highly decorative vine & grape cluster border. In near excellent, clean antiquarian condition on a c.15 1/4 " W x 12 1/8 " H sheet. Image area c. 13 3/4 " W x 11 1/4 " H.
